I went into Nickerson State Park again today looking for a photo. It was so gray and cloudy, I didn't have much hope for a good shot. As I was leaving the park, a deer ran in front of my Jeep. She ran away before I could get a shot, but when I looked in the woods where she came from there were two more does. One stayed still long enough for a photo. Wish I had a better zoom, but I'm happy with the surprise catch.

How lucky are you? Good one. To your question - Rosella Jam is made from the fruit of a small bush called a rosella which belongs to the hibiscus family. You strip off the outer husk, soak the seed pod in hot water over night, pour this liquid over the husks and boil until soft and jelly by adding equal amount of sugar to the reduced pulp.
